What Is a Brand?

startup logos on Logomakerr.ai

Many founders confuse branding with graphic design.

A logo is not a brand.

A website is not a brand.

A color palette is not a brand.

A brand is the overall perception people have about your company.

It is the feeling customers experience when they interact with your business.

Consider two companies with nearly identical products.

One company appears:

  • Trustworthy
  • Professional
  • Reliable

The other appears:

  • Inconsistent
  • Generic
  • Forgettable

The difference is branding.

The Five Foundations of Startup Branding

1. Brand Identity

Brand identity includes visual elements such as:

  • Logos
  • Colors
  • Typography
  • Design systems

These assets create recognition.

A professional visual identity helps startups appear more credible.

2. Brand Positioning

Positioning defines how customers perceive your company relative to competitors.

Ask yourself:

  • Why should customers choose you?
  • What makes your business different?
  • What problem do you solve better than others?

Strong positioning creates clarity.

Weak positioning creates confusion.

3. Brand Messaging

Many startups spend weeks designing logos but only minutes crafting their messaging.

Messaging includes:

  • Headlines
  • Taglines
  • Value propositions
  • Website copy
  • Marketing content

Clear messaging improves conversions.

Customers should immediately understand:

  • What you do
  • Who you help
  • Why it matters

4. Customer Experience

Every customer interaction influences your brand.

This includes:

  • Customer support
  • Product quality
  • Website usability
  • Response times
  • Communication

Many companies invest heavily in branding while ignoring customer experience.

That is a mistake.

Customer experience often becomes the brand.

5. Brand Consistency

Consistency creates familiarity.

Customers should encounter the same brand personality across:

  • Websites
  • Social media
  • Email campaigns
  • Advertisements
  • Customer support

Consistency builds trust over time.

Why Trust Is the Most Valuable Brand Asset

Trust has become one of the most important factors in purchasing decisions.

Customers evaluate:

  • Reviews
  • Testimonials
  • Security
  • Reputation
  • Transparency

before making purchases.

Without trust, even the most attractive branding will struggle to convert visitors into customers.

Trust is built through:

  • Consistent delivery
  • Honest communication
  • Positive customer experiences

It cannot be manufactured through design alone.
